9. A central station is supplying energy to a community through two substations. Each substation feeds four feeders. The maximum daily recorded demands are : POWER STATION. 12,000 KW Sub-station B .. 9000 kW Feeder 1.. Feeder 2. Feeder 3. Substation A . 600 kW Feeder 1.. Feeder 2. 1700 kW 1800 kW 2820 kW 1500 kW Feeder 3 2800 kW . 4000 kW Feeder 4 600 kW Feeder 4 2900 kW Calculate the diversity factor between (i) substations (ii) feeders on substation A and (ii) feeders on sub- station B. |() 1-25 (i) 1-15 (ii) 1-24]
